Pirate girls basketball dominated by Bearcats

By Cort Reynolds

SPENCERVILLE__The visiting Bluffton High School girls basketball team lost 59-32 to Northwest Conference foe Spencerville on February 1.

Bearcat sophomore Clara Goecke bombed in 24 points on 11 field goals to lead Spencerville to victory. She scored 10 of her points in the third period behind a pair of triples.

The Pirates fell behind 16-6 after the first period as Bearcat senior Heidi Keller nailed two treys and netted eight early points.

Goecke tallied six markers in the second stanza as Spencerville built a 29-17 halftime edge.

Spencerville stretched the margin to 43-27 going into the final period of play. The Bearcats pulled away with a 16-5 fourth quarter to win by 27.

The Pirates fell to 7-11 overall and 1-5 in NWC play with the surprisingly one-sided road defeat. Meanwhile, the Bearcat girls improved to 11-8 and 2-4 in the NWC after the victory. 

Sophomore Blair Utendorf, junior post Ayla Grandey and Lauren Bassett each scored five points to lead the cold-shooting Pirates.

Keller supported Goecke with 14 markers. 

The Pirates sank 11 two-point goals and made just one trey. Bluffton converted seven of 11 free throws (64 percent).

The Bearcats nailed 16 deuces and drained six trifectas. The visitors connected on nine of 13 foul shots (69 percent).

Bluffton was outscored 30-13 in the second half.
